Step-by-Step Recipe
Ingredients (serves 4)
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 3 tbsp butter, divided
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- ½ cup chicken stock or dry white wine
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- 1 tsp fresh thyme leaves (or ½ tsp dried thyme)
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tbsp chopped parsley for garnish
Preparation
- Prepare the chicken. Pat the chicken dry with paper towels and season generously with salt and pepper on both sides.
- Sear the chicken. Heat olive oil and 1 tablespoon of butter in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ook for 4–5 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through. Remove and set aside.
- Make the garlic butter sauce. In the same pan, reduce the heat to medium. Add the remaining butter and minced garlic. Sauté for 30 seconds to 1 minute until fragrant, being careful not to burn the garlic.
- Deglaze the pan. Pour in chicken stock or wine,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om of the pan. Simmer for 2–3 minutes until slightly reduced.
- Finish the sauce. Stir in lemon juice and thyme. Return the chicken to the pan, spooning the sauce over it. Simmer for another 2 minutes to heat through.
- Serve. Garnish with chopped parsley and serve warm with extra sauce spooned over the top.
Tips for the Perfect Chicken with Garlic Butter Sauce
- Use room-temperature chicken for even cooking.
- Don’t overcrowd the pan; sear in batches if necessary.
- Use fresh garlic for the best flavor.
- Add a splash of cream for a richer sauce.
- Finish with lemon juice to balance the butter’s richness.

Make-Ahead and Storage
Make-ahead: Cook the chicken and prepare the sauce separately. Combine and reheat before serving.
Storage: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Reheating: Reheat gently on the stove over low heat, adding a splash of stock or butter to refresh the sauce.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them
Burnt garlic: Cook garlic over medium heat and stir constantly.
Dry chicken: Don’t overcook; remove from heat once it reaches 165°F (74°C).
Greasy sauce: Balance butter with stock or lemon juice.
Bland flavor: Season each layer — chicken, sauce, and garnish.
Watery sauce: Simmer until slightly thickened before serving.
